The cheap laser welder machine represents a revolutionary approach to precision welding technology, offering professional-grade capabilities at an affordable price point. These machines utilize focused laser beams to create high-quality welds across various materials, making them essential tools for small businesses, educational institutions, and hobbyist workshops. A cheap laser welder machine typically operates using fiber laser technology, generating concentrated heat that melts and fuses materials together with exceptional accuracy. The core functionality revolves around converting electrical energy into laser light through diode pumping systems, creating a coherent beam that can be precisely controlled for welding applications. Modern cheap laser welder machines feature adjustable power settings, allowing operators to customize welding parameters based on material thickness and type. The technological architecture includes advanced beam delivery systems that maintain consistent power output while minimizing heat-affected zones. These machines excel in processing stainless steel, carbon steel, aluminum, and various alloys with remarkable precision. The compact design of most cheap laser welder machine units makes them suitable for workspace-constrained environments while maintaining industrial-grade performance standards. Control systems typically incorporate user-friendly interfaces with programmable welding sequences, enabling consistent results across production runs. Safety features include protective housings, emergency stop functions, and integrated cooling systems that prevent overheating during extended operation periods. The versatility of cheap laser welder machines extends to applications ranging from automotive repair and jewelry making to electronics manufacturing and prototype development. Advanced models incorporate real-time monitoring capabilities that track welding parameters and provide feedback for quality assurance. The technology behind these machines continues evolving, with manufacturers implementing more efficient laser sources and improved beam delivery mechanisms that enhance overall performance while maintaining cost-effectiveness.

The cheap laser welder machine delivers exceptional value by combining advanced welding capabilities with budget-friendly pricing, making professional-grade laser welding accessible to businesses of all sizes. These machines significantly reduce operational costs compared to traditional welding methods, eliminating the need for consumable materials like welding rods, gas, or flux. The precision offered by a cheap laser welder machine surpasses conventional welding techniques, creating clean, narrow welds with minimal distortion and heat-affected zones. This precision translates directly into reduced material waste and lower rework rates, improving overall production efficiency and profitability. The speed advantage of laser welding technology allows operators to complete projects faster than traditional methods, increasing throughput and reducing labor costs per unit. Energy efficiency represents another compelling benefit, as cheap laser welder machines consume less power than many conventional welding systems while delivering superior results. The versatility of these machines enables users to weld dissimilar materials and work with extremely thin sections that would be challenging or impossible with traditional welding approaches. Maintenance requirements remain minimal due to the solid-state nature of laser technology, reducing downtime and long-term operating expenses. The clean welding process produces no spatter or fumes, creating safer working environments and eliminating post-weld cleanup requirements. Automation capabilities built into many cheap laser welder machine models allow for consistent, repeatable results that reduce dependency on operator skill levels. The compact footprint of these machines maximizes valuable floor space utilization while providing full welding capabilities. Quality improvements achieved through laser welding technology often eliminate secondary finishing operations, further reducing production costs and cycle times. Remote welding capabilities enable operators to work in confined spaces or hazardous environments safely, expanding application possibilities. The non-contact nature of laser welding prevents tool wear and eliminates the need for frequent electrode replacements. Training requirements are typically minimal, allowing operators to become productive quickly while maintaining safety standards throughout the learning process.

Exceptional Versatility Across Multiple Materials and Applications

Exceptional Versatility Across Multiple Materials and Applications

The cheap laser welder machine demonstrates remarkable versatility by successfully processing an extensive range of materials and applications, making it an invaluable asset for diverse manufacturing environments. This versatility stems from sophisticated laser control systems that automatically adjust welding parameters based on material properties and thickness requirements. Stainless steel welding capabilities extend from ultra-thin foils used in electronics to substantial structural components, with the machine adapting power output and beam characteristics accordingly. Carbon steel applications benefit from the precise heat control that prevents unwanted carbide formation while maintaining optimal penetration depths. Aluminum welding capabilities represent a significant advantage, as the cheap laser welder machine overcomes traditional challenges associated with aluminum's high reflectivity and thermal conductivity through specialized wavelength selection and power modulation techniques. The machine excels in joining dissimilar materials, creating strong metallurgical bonds between different alloy systems that would be problematic with conventional welding methods. Copper and brass applications benefit from the concentrated heat input that minimizes thermal distortion while achieving full penetration welds. The versatility extends to exotic alloys used in aerospace and medical applications, where the controlled atmosphere welding environment prevents contamination and oxidation. Jewelry applications showcase the machine's ability to work with precious metals while maintaining aesthetic quality and structural integrity. Electronics manufacturing benefits from the precise heat control that prevents damage to sensitive components while creating reliable electrical connections. Automotive applications range from body panel repairs to engine component manufacturing, demonstrating the machine's adaptability to both high-volume production and specialized repair work. The ability to switch between different welding modes enables users to optimize performance for specific applications, whether prioritizing speed, penetration depth, or surface finish quality. This exceptional versatility eliminates the need for multiple specialized welding systems, providing significant cost savings and workspace efficiency improvements.
